The following table illustrates the speeds at which the evaporator fan is switched on during the operating cycles.

A different speed can be selected using the procedure given in 6.12.1 (intended as one of the speeds 1.. 5) in

temporary mode (i.e. if a power cut occurs, on restore of the same the speeds illustrated in the following table will be

shown), except if the selection is made before starting a blast chilling and storage cycle or before starting a hard blast

chilling and storage cycle or before starting a soft deep freezing and storage cycle (in this case the speeds are

memorised instead).

6.12.1

Selecting the evaporator fan speed

Operate as follows:

1.

Press and release the BLAST CHILLING INTENSITY key: the LED bars will supply information relative to fan

speed (for example, one bar corresponds to speed 1, two bars on correspond to speed 2, three bars on

correspond to speed 3, etc.).

Pressing and releasing the BLAST CHILLING INTENSITY key causes the speed to be selected in pre-defined mode, as

indicated:

-

speed 5 - speed 4 - speed 3 - speed 2 - speed 1 - speed 2 - speed 3 - speed 4 - speed 5.

The fan is switched on at the selected speed after 5 s from release of the BLAST CHILLING INTENSITY key.
